Transaction 5423801a2efcb3c210743c389a04c039bbdf086eb5c25fdd8b3b03bb1f91de8a
1 Input
1 Output
-
5423801a2efcb3c210743c389a04c039bbdf086eb5c25fdd8b3b03bb1f91de8a:0
- value
- 619047
- script pubkey
- OP_0 OP_PUSHBYTES_20 de0bb7befe5e5d17eb986b21c6000d9b993e56d2
- address
- bc1qmc9m00h7tew306ucdvsuvqqdnwvnu4kjjld3v8